問題タブ [visual-c++-2010-express]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
1899 参照

c++ - Visual C++ 2010 で glew32 をリンクできませんでした

次のリンクエラーが発生します。1>main.obj: エラー LNK2001: 未解決の外部シンボル ___glewGenBuffers

glew の 32 ビット バージョンをダウンロードし、プロジェクトに「includes」および「lib」ディレクトリを含めました。また、追加の依存関係メニューに glew32.lib を追加しました。次に、glew32.dll と glew32mx.dll を syswow64 フォルダーと system32 フォルダーに配置しました (syswow64 に配置してもエラーが発生するため)。かなり単純なプログラムです。hello world のように、SDL と GLEW を使用して OpenGL を作成します。プログラムは、SDL セットアップだけで機能しました。グリューをリンクした後、問題が発生しました。

私はWindows 7 Premium 64ビット(今ではかなり明白)のVisual C++ 2010エクスプレスエディションを使用しています。glew の私のバージョンは glew-1.9.0-win32 です。

どこが間違っているのでしょうか?

ここにコードがあります

0 投票する
2 に答える
135 参照

c++ - ウィザード wiz0 はなぜですか。Wizard wiz0() と同等ではありません。私のコードで?C2228 エラー

重複の可能性:
引数のないコンストラクターに括弧がないことは言語標準ですか?

さて、私はピクルスを持っています。これはエラー C2228 の問題です。他の質問と回答を調べましたが、与えられたヒントはどれもうまくいかないようです。これは私の最初の質問であり、私は初心者なので、優しくしてください! 注:使用すると、プログラムはコンパイルされます

しかし、私が使用する場合はそうではありません

私が使用している本では、これら 2 つのステートメントは等価であると書かれているため、一方を使用して他方を使用できない理由を理解しようとしています。

まず、ウィザード wiz0() を使用しようとすると、次のエラーが表示されます。

これが(私が思うに)Chapter5.cppの関連コードです:

また、wiz.h ファイルからの情報は次のとおりです。

...そして最後に、wiz.cpp ファイルからの情報です!

ふぅ……これで全部だと思います。あなたが私が間違っていることを理解できるなら、私はそれを大いに感謝します!

0 投票する
3 に答える
8884 参照

c++ - free.c が「このプログラムは動作を停止しました」という例外をスローする

プログラム (server.exe) を Visual C++ 2010 Express のデバッガーで実行すると完全に実行されますが、exe として実行すると実行されません。「Server.exe が動作を停止しました」ダイアログでクラッシュします。

次に、exe の名前を「ServerInstaller.exe」に変更したところ、機能したので、アクセス許可エラーであると考えましたが、管理者モードの「Server.exe」では機能しません。

次に、VC++ のデバッガーを "Server.exe" プログラムにアタッチすると、"free.c" で例外が発生しました。

このファイルのコードは

例外は

Server.exe の 0x770ae3be で未処理の例外: 0xC0000005: アクセス違反の読み取り場所 0x3765f8c7。

pBlock の値を調べたところ、0x007f82c0 です。

私のプログラム。

私のプログラムは RakNet サーバーで、プレーヤーが正常に削除されました。サーバーはその時点で RakNet からのメッセージをチェックしています。

スタック トレース バック

0 投票する
1 に答える
2048 参照

visual-studio-2010 - Win32 コンソール アプリケーションを作成できません

新しいプロジェクトを作成しようとしてクリックし、名前を選択すると、ダイアログ ボックスが開いて次のように表示されます。

ボタン、クリックできません。IDE の下部に「プロジェクトの作成中」と表示されますが、閉じる以外に何もクリックできません。閉じると、「終了」をクリックできるため、プロジェクトはありません。 . IDE の何が問題になっていますか?

Visual C++ Express Edition 2010 を使用しています。

以前はプロジェクトを作成できましたが、再起動、再インストールを試みましたが、機能しません。

0 投票する
1 に答える
2026 参照

c++ - Visual C++ Forms アプリケーションが他のコンピューターで実行されない

私は C++ に非常に慣れていないので、Visual C++ Express 2010 を使用して単純なフォーム アプリケーションを作成しようとしています。ヘッダー ファイルと .cpp ファイルだけで、コンピューター上で完全に実行されたときに、エラーなしでコンパイルできました。大丈夫。コンパイル済みの .exe を友人に渡して実行させようとしたところ、実行されませんでした。彼は .NET Framework 4.5 と Visual C++ 2010 再頒布可能パッケージを持っていましたが、それでも動作しませんでした。彼は、まったく起動しないと言います(エラーメッセージが表示されるかどうかはわかりません)。プログラムにあったのは、ラベルを変更するボタンだけでした。私は自分のコンピューター以外ではこれを動作させることができないように見えるので、ここで髪を引き裂いています。これが別のコンピューターで実行されない理由を理解してください。これは私が作ったエラーかもしれないので、コードは下にあります。ご覧のとおり、 3 に変更しました。cpp ファイルを調べて、それが機能するかどうかを確認します。ここには無意味なコードがたくさんありますが、それでも問題なくコンパイルされます。

^^これはもともと Header1.h というヘッダー ファイルであったことに注意してください。

このファイルはほとんど意味がありません。なぜなら、それが行うことはすべてメイン関数で実行できるか、クラスがメイン プロジェクト ファイルにある可能性さえあるからです。動作するかどうか試してみましたが、役に立ちませんでした。

繰り返しますが、助けていただければ幸いです。これが長すぎてばかげた質問だったらごめんなさい

0 投票する
1 に答える
337 参照

breakpoints - MS Visual C++ 2010 Express - ブレークポイント (赤い点) が表示されない

MS Visual C++ Express 2010 でブレークポイントを設定すると、ブレークポイントの位置に「赤い点」が表示されます。突然、この「赤い点」が消えました。ブレークポイントが設定されていますが、場所が表示されなくなりました。これを修正する方法を知っている人はいますか?

0 投票する
1 に答える
3416 参照

c++ - boost::geometry ポリゴンのコンパイル

boost::geometry ポリゴン クラスを使用して、交差点とその面積を計算しようとしています。ポリゴンを定義する独自の 3d piont クラスがあります。ただし、area() またはintersection() を使用しようとすると、多くのコンパイル エラーが発生します。

いくつかの定義が欠けていること、または余分な REGISTER マクロが欠けていることはわかっていますが、どちらが欠けているのかわかりません。

ブースト 1.54、VC++ 2010 Express を使用しています。

以下は、コンパイルされない単純なプログラムです。コンパイルするにはどうすればよいですか?

コンパイル エラー:

0 投票する
2 に答える
12111 参照

javascript - javascriptを使用してフォルダー内のファイルのリストを取得する方法

デスクトップアプリケーションのプロジェクトに取り組んでいます。Visual C++ でQtコントロールを使用しています。QWebViewにhtmlファイルをロードしています。

ここで、たとえば、「c:\demo」という場所にいくつか.zipのファイルがあり、そのディレクトリに存在するファイルのリスト (またはファイル名の配列) が必要です。

javascript を使用してこれを行うにはどうすればよいですか?

PS:このリンクをたどりましたが、要件と一致しませんでした。私は、html、javascript、および jquery を使用したことがありません。私を助けてください。

0 投票する
1 に答える
781 参照

c++ - CSmtp は電子メールの添付ファイルを送信しません。しかし、アタッチメントがなくても問題なく動作します。(c++)

CSmtp classを使用して添付ファイルを送信する際に問題があります。
そのリンクのコードは次のとおりです。

添付ファイルの行にコメントを付けると、電子メールが正常に送信されます。しかし、その添付ファイルを送信しようとすると、そこで停止して何もしないように見えます-エラーも何も返されません。何もしないだけです(ただし、タスクマネージャーによると、応答しています)。

また、2 つ目の質問があります。添付ファイルのパス (C:\Users\Jenda\AppData\Roaming\text.dat) が表示されますか? プログラムがユーザー (名前) に関する情報を取得する方法と、それをパスに追加してすべてのコンピューターで機能する方法を教えてください。C:\Users\ WINDOWSUSERNAME \...

以上です。すべての回答とアイデアに感謝します。

PS Windows7 32bit と Visual c++ Express 2010 を使用しています。

0 投票する
1 に答える
2203 参照

c++ - C++ - 日本語の文字の表示と保存

そこで、C++ と Windows Forms を使用して、日本語の学習に役立つアプリケーションを作成しようとしています (今のところ、ひらがなとカタカナのみ)。目的は、ユーザーが使用したい文字セット (A から O、KA から KO など) を選択し、カードを自由に表示するか、プログラムに文字でテストさせるプログラムを作成できるようにすることです。 . デバッグの目的で、現在、5 つの値を 5 つの異なるテキスト ボックスに出力するように [表示] ボタンを設定しています。ローマ字の発音、対応する文字、すべての文字が格納されている配列内の位置、およびブール値です。

私の問題は、文字がすべて「?」として表示され、コンパイル時に複数の警告が表示されることです。この警告の例:

1>c:\users\cameron\documents\visual studio 2010\projects\japanesecards\japanesecards\Form1.h(218): 警告 C4566: ユニバーサル文字名 '\u3093' で表される文字は、現在のコードでは表現できませんページ (1252)

これは、配列内の日本語の文字ごとに 1 つずつ、合計 46 回表示されます。配列の宣言行は、

ローマ字とひらがなのペアを挿入する例は、

最後に、次のコードを使用してひらがなをテキスト ボックスに挿入します。

基本的に、これらすべてを考慮して、私の質問は、どうすればフォームにテキスト ボックスに日本語の文字を正しく表示させることができますか?